  5. What are the most important safety precautions to take in a darkroom?

    • Answer: The most important safety precautions include proper ventilation to avoid inhaling chemical fumes, wearing app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) like gloves and eye protection, careful handling of chemicals to prevent spills, and proper disposal of used chemicals according to regulations.
  6. How would you handle a chemical spill in the darkroom?

    • Answer: I would immediately evacuate the area and alert the appropriate personnel. Then, following established protocols, I would contain the spill using absorbent materials, and neutralize the chemical according to its specific requirements. Finally, I would properly dispose of the contaminated materials.
